Faux wood siding offers a durable and low-maintenance alternative to traditional wood, suitable for residential exteriors in State College, PA. Understanding the typical aspects of installation can help homeowners plan and compare options effectively.
- Materials: Common options include vinyl, composite, and fiber cement siding designed to mimic wood grain and texture.
- Size and Scope: Projects typically cover entire exterior walls or specific sections, with panel lengths ranging from 12 to 16 feet for easier installation.
- Labor Complexity: Installation involves precise measurement, cutting, and fastening, with complexity varying based on existing surface conditions and architectural features.
- Permitting: Local building codes in State College may require permits for siding replacement or installation, especially for larger projects.
- Extras: Additional components such as trim, corner posts, and ventilation details may be needed to complete the installation professionally.

Faux Wood Siding Installation
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Single-story home (1,200 sq ft) | $7,000 - $12,000 |
| Two-story home (2,400 sq ft) | $14,000 - $24,000 |
| Additional accent areas (e.g., gables, trims) | $500 - $2,000 |
| Removal of existing siding |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Labor (per square foot) | $4 - $8 |
In State College, PA, project costs for faux wood siding installation can vary based on the home's size and complexity of the work.
